6. Cleaning
Warning!
Allow the appliance to cool down and
pull out the mains plug before
cleaning.
Never immerse mains cable 1 and
temperature regulator 3 in liquids.
Note: drip tray 9 and grill plate 6 are
dishwasher-safe.
1. Take mains cable 1 and temperature
regulator 3 out of connecting socket 4.
2. Clean temperature regulator 3 with a clean,
dry cloth. If necessary, you can also moisten
the cloth slightly, but moisture must never be
allowed to get into the temperature regulator.
3. Carefully remove the drip tray 9 and dispose
of the collected fat.
Note: Normal domestic quantities can be
disposed of as domestic waste. Do not pour
the fat down the drain, as it may solidify and
cause blockages.
4. Clean drip tray 9 and grill plate 6 in
washing-up water by hand or in a
dishwasher.
5. Clean base section 8 with a damp cloth or a
soft, damp sponge. You may also use a little
mild detergent in order to help remove fatty
deposits.
Caution! Never use caustic or abrasive
cleaning agents, as they could damage your
appliance and the nonstick coating of the
grill plate 6. Grilled food will stick to a
damaged surface.
6. The wooden spatula 10 can be washed by
hand in dishwater.
7. Use the appliance only again if after the
cleaning the mains cable 1, the temperature
regulator 3 and the connection socket 4 are
completely dried.
8. Do not place the connecting cable or any
other objects on the grill plate 6.
